A sinusoidal wave travelling in the -x direction (to the left) has an amplitude of 20.0 cm, a wavelength of 35.0 cm, and a frequency of 12.0 Hz. The transverse position of an element of the medium at t=0, x=0 is y=-3.00 cm, and the element has a positive velocity here.

(a) Sketch the wave at t = 0.

(b) Find the angular wave number, period, angular frequency, and wave speed of the wave.

(c) Write an expression for the wave function y(x, t).
